Secret At Orient Point

Rate this book
Were they destined for tragedy? Twenty years earlier, on the mist-shrouded North Fork of Long Island, Erika's mother was murdered by her lover. Erika's father closed his hotel and left to sail the seven seas, while Erika was whisked away to live with an aunt. Now Erika was back to reopen the hotel, and lay to rest the ghosts. But they refused to comply. The eerie strains of a waltz drifted from the deserted hotel ballroom; someone, or something, stalked her at night; then a fire ... But most terrifying of all was the fatal attraction between Erika and David. For he was the son of the man who murdered her mother-and he was Erika's half brother..
